Output 3a80cfb3bb63ab9a1e369eea786d4b34660013d6123fa70625abc9dae5b9076e:6

value
99014
script pubkey
OP_0 OP_PUSHBYTES_20 7ef3ca1265579c4626deb9bbec73e48c5e8d4820
address
bc1q0meu5yn927wyvfk7hxa7culy330g6jpqdfnaec
transaction
3a80cfb3bb63ab9a1e369eea786d4b34660013d6123fa70625abc9dae5b9076e
spent
true